What is TRX Energy Leasing?

Energy leasing in TRON is the process of borrowing energy from other users who have surplus resources. It enables temporary access to energy without the need for long-term freezing of TRX, making it ideal for developers executing resource-intensive smart contracts or businesses conducting multiple transactions in a short period.

Leasing energy can also create passive income for users with surplus TRX, as they can lend energy to others in exchange for rental fees. The leasing mechanism has evolved into a robust marketplace where supply, demand, and pricing are determined dynamically, reflecting the real-time state of the network.

How TRX Energy Leasing Works

The mechanics of TRX energy leasing are straightforward but powerful:

  • Resource Supply: Users with frozen TRX often have surplus energy that they can lease out.

  • Leasing Platforms: Specialized platforms facilitate the leasing process, handling resource allocation, payment, and contract enforcement.

  • Temporary Access: Borrowers receive energy for a fixed period, enough to perform transactions or deploy smart contracts without freezing additional TRX.

  • Automated Settlements: Once the leasing period ends, energy is automatically returned to the lender, and rental fees are settled in TRX.

This system allows for seamless and efficient energy exchange, reducing transaction friction and providing financial incentives for both lenders and borrowers.

Energy Leasing Platforms

TRX energy leasing is facilitated through specialized platforms that connect lenders and borrowers. These platforms provide transparency in pricing, rental duration, and available resources. Advanced platforms may also include automation features such as threshold-based leasing, where energy is automatically rented when levels drop below a preset amount, ensuring uninterrupted operations.

Key features of leasing platforms include:

  • Real-time monitoring of energy availability

  • Dynamic pricing based on supply and demand

  • Automated rental and settlement processes

  • Secure and transparent smart contract enforcement

Cost Considerations

The cost of energy leasing depends on market demand, supply, and rental duration. Users should balance the cost of leasing with the benefits of operational flexibility. Short-term leases may be cheaper in low-demand periods, while longer leases offer stability during high-activity periods.

Lenders can set competitive rental prices, taking into account current network conditions and expected demand. By analyzing historical data and transaction trends, lenders can maximize earnings while maintaining market competitiveness.

Challenges and Risks

While energy leasing offers numerous benefits, there are risks to consider:

  • Market Volatility: Energy prices fluctuate with network demand, impacting leasing costs.

  • Platform Reliability: Dependence on third-party leasing platforms requires trust in their security and operation.

  • Insufficient Energy: If energy is not leased in time, transactions may fail, affecting dApp performance or business operations.

To mitigate these risks, users should diversify leasing sources, monitor network activity, and maintain a minimum reserve of frozen TRX as a fallback.
